New indie fills Commercial Street’s last empty shop.

New business Wave Aquariums opened its doors for the first time on Saturday. A good turnout browsed a variety of tropical fish with customers wasting no time in making purchases.

The shop, on the vibrant and popular Commercial Street, is run by Jonny Rhodes. Jonny’s lifelong fascination with aquatics – having worked as a scuba diving instructor and kept fish since he was a boy – compelled him to open Wave Aquariums so he can share his knowledge of and passion for marine life.

The shop sells aquariums of varying sizes and has everything you need to fill one including tropical fish, corals and an array of equipment and nutrients to ensure the conditions are right for the fish.

The new enterprise was opened by Andrew Jones, Member of Parliament for Harrogate and Knaresborough. Mr Jones said: “I was delighted to be invited to the opening of Wave Aquariums and it was great to see so many people supporting local businesses.

“Jonny is extremely knowledgeable about marine life and is on hand to offer advice to his customers as well as providing them with all the tools they need for their aquarium.

“It is a great example of why shops – particularly independent ones – are still relevant as face-to-face advice is invaluable when buying specialised products such as aquariums.”

There was only one empty unit on Commercial Street and now that Wave Aquariums has filled this it means this characterful mecca of independent local businesses is back to full strength.
